About the QS World University Rankings

The QS World University Rankings are published annually by Quacquarelli Symonds (QS) and are widely regarded as one of the three most influential global university rankings. Universities are evaluated on six indicators: Academic Reputation (40%), Employer Reputation (10%), Faculty-to-Student Ratio (20%), Citations per Faculty (20%), International Faculty Ratio (5%), and International Student Ratio (5%).
